Understanding Obamacare
By Aaron Peterson, Editor Agents Advantage
As part of the Affordable Care Act individual mandate, U.S. citizens and legal residents will be required to have qualifying health coverage starting in 2014. Those who do not have insurance through their employer or through Medicaid or Medicare will have the option to go to a new marketplace in their state to enroll in a private healthcare plan. Open enrollment in the exchanges will last from Oct. 1, 2013, through March 31, 2014; coverage will begin as early as Jan. 1, 2014.
Government Shutdown - Now What?
By Kevin Lashus, Esq, of Jackson Lewis LLP
The failure of Congress to agree on a new budget for the Fiscal Year (beginning October 1) is resulting in a furlough of more than 800,000 federal workers and government agencies temporarily closing or cutting back the operations of numerous federal facilities and the suspension of many services. This is the first government shutdown in 17 years.
